Search by job, company or skills

Shopee

Expert Algorithm Data Engineer - Marketplace Intelligence & Data

5-7 Years
new job description bg glownew job description bg glownew job description bg svg
  • Posted a month ago
  • Be among the first 10 applicants
Early Applicant

Job Description

Job Description:

As an Algorithm Data Engineer, you will be responsible for transforming data into algorithmic productivity across the following key areas:

1. Unified Feature Platform Development

Lead or participate in the design, development, and maintenance of enterprise-level feature platforms/feature stores. Tackle challenges such as online/offline feature consistency, real-time processing, and high availability. Ensure standardization and automation of the feature engineering workflow to improve feature development efficiency for algorithm teams.

2. High-Quality Dataset Construction & Maintenance

Design and build high-performance, low-latency offline and real-time datasets for model training, evaluation, and inference. Optimize data pipelines and ETL processes to significantly enhance large-scale data processing efficiency and data quality.

3. Algorithm Experimentation & Monitoring Pipeline

Contribute to the development and maintenance of core data pipelines for algorithm experimentation. Provide end-to-end support-from data preparation, configuration, and runtime monitoring to metrics analysis and result evaluation.

4. High-Value Label & Graph Mining

Leverage deep understanding of e-commerce and algorithmic needs to extract high-value user profiles, product tags, and relationship graphs from massive behavioral data, effectively enabling both algorithms and business strategies.

5. Architecture Optimization & Technology Exploration

Continuously improve the data architecture, including real-time processing, unified batch-stream systems, multimodal data processing, and compute resource optimization. Maintain a cutting-edge and robust technology stack.


Requirements:

  • Bachelor's degree or above in Computer Science or a related field, with 5+ years of experience in big data.
  • Hands-on experience with one or more big data technologies such as Spark, Flink, Hadoop, HBase, Kafka, Druid, ClickHouse, etc.
  • Proficient in one or more programming languages, such as Python, Java, Scala, or SQL.
  • Experience in data architecture design, data warehouse modeling, or performance tuning is preferred.
  • Prior experience with feature platforms/feature stores, algorithm experimentation pipelines, or graph construction is a plus.
  • Strong logical thinking, communication skills, and project coordination abilities
  • Strong self-motivation and resilience, with a willingness to experiment and drive business impact.

More Info

Job Type:
Employment Type:

About Company

Shopee Pte. Ltd. is a Singaporean multinational technology company that specialises in e-commerce. The company was launched in Singapore in 2015, before it expanded abroad. As of 2021, Shopee is considered the largest e-commerce platform in Southeast Asia with 343 million monthly visitors.

Job ID: 135424279